IPL 2022 final champion: Star India all-rounder Hardik Pandya led his Gujarat Titans from the front as they defeated Rajasthan Royals by 7 wickets in the IPL 2022 final here at Narendra Modi Stadium in Ahmedabad in front of a record crowd on Sunday (May 29). Here is the full list of award winners from the Final:

Super Striker in the Final: David Miller (GT) – Rs 1 lakh

Dream11 Game changer of the match – Hardik Pandya (GT) – Rs 1 lakh

Let’s Crack It Sixes of the match – Yashasvi Jaiswal (RR) – Rs 1 lakh

Power Player of the match – Trent Boult (RR) – Rs 1 lakh

Upstox Most Valuable Asset of the match – Hardik Pandya (GT) – Rs 1 lakh

Swiggy Instamart Fastest Delivery of the match – Lockie Ferguson (GT) – Rs 1 lakh

Rupay on the go Fours – Jos Buttler (RR) – 5 fours – Rs 1 lakh

Player of the match in Final – Hardik Pandya (INR 5 lakh).

Gujarat Titans didn’t just lift the IPL trophy, but also pocketed a cheque of a whopping sum of Rs 20 crore. The BCCI awards the mega sum to the IPL champions. RR, who finished as the runners-up, were given a cheque of Rs 12.5 crore. GT captain Hardik Pandya collected the cheque of Rs 20 crore during the presentation ceremony.

Here is the list of all the IPL 2022 award winners, prize money details

Winner: Gujarat Titans (GT); Prize money: Rs 20 crore.

Runner-up: Rajasthan Royals (RR) – Rs 13 crore.

Third place: Royal Challengers Bangalore (RCB) – Rs 7 crore.

Fourth place: Lucknow Super Giants (LSG) – Rs 6.5 crore.

Player of the final: Hardik Pandya (Gujarat Titans) – Rs 5 lakh.

Fair play award: Gujarat and Rajasthan.

Orange Cap: Jos Buttler (Rajasthan); 863 runs in 17 matches (4 100s; 4 50s; strike rate 149.05; average 57.53; 83 fours; 45 sixes; highest score 116) – Rs 10 lakh.

Purple Cap: Yuzvendra Chahal (Rajasthan); 27 wickets in 17 matches (economy 7.75; average 19.51; 68 overs; 527 runs) – Rs 10 lakh.

Emerging Player of the tournament: Umran Malik (Sunrisers Hyderabad); 22 wickets in 14 matches – Rs 10 lakh.

Most Valuable Player: Buttler (387.5 points) – Rs 10 lakh.

Maximum sixes award: Buttler (45 sixes) – Rs 10 lakh.

Most fours: Buttler (83 fours) – Rs 10 lakh.

Game-changer of the season: Buttler – Rs 10 lakh.

Super Striker of the season: Dinesh Karthik (Royal Challengers Bangalore); Strike rate 183.33 – Tata Punch car.

Fastest delivery of the season: Lockie Ferguson (Gujarat); 157.3 kmph – Rs 10 lakh.

Powerplayer of the season: Buttler – Rs 10 lakh.

Catch of the season: Evin Lewis (Lucknow Super Giants) – Rs 10 lakh.
